Summary:

Gray, Louisiana, is home to a single high school, H. L. Bourgeois High School, which serves grades 9 through 12 with a large enrollment of 1,289 students as part of the Terrebonne Parish school district.

H. L. Bourgeois High School shows a mixed academic profile. It outperforms the state average in several key subjects, including Geometry (64% vs. 57%), English II (71% vs. 67%), and U.S. History (58% vs. 55%) for the most recent school year. However, its state ranking has been declining, dropping from the 71st percentile (4 stars) in 2023-2024 to the 54th percentile (3 stars) in 2025-2026, indicating that other schools are improving at a faster pace. The school also has a high student-teacher ratio of 17.4:1 and a significant percentage of students (68.97%) eligible for free or reduced lunch.

The most critical challenge facing the school is chronic absenteeism, which stands at 34.7%—far above the district (26.7%) and state (22.5%) averages. Despite this, the school maintains a graduation rate of 86.0%, which is above the state average of 85.0%. This paradox suggests effective credit recovery programs may be in place, but it also raises concerns about student preparedness. Test scores show notable year-to-year volatility, such as English I dropping from 75% to 64% and Geometry falling from 70% to 64%, pointing to inconsistent performance that may depend on specific student cohorts or instructional changes.
